A client certificate is a digital certificate used to authenticate the identity of a client to a server. It is used to provide secure and encrypted communications between the client and the server. An example of a client certificate is a digital certificate issued by a Certificate Authority (CA) to a user who wants to connect to a secure website.
A server certificate is a digital certificate used to authenticate the identity of a server to a client. It is used to provide secure and encrypted communications between the server and the client. An example of a server certificate is a digital certificate issued by a Certificate Authority (CA) to a web server that wants to communicate securely with clients.
